Card values hinge on condition and grading status, with mint and graded cards commanding premium prices. Rarity plays a major role, especially for cards from limited print releases or special editions.
Demand from both tournament competitors and nostalgic collectors in Rock Hill influences prices. Print runs, local and national market trends, and recent sales contribute to ongoing valuation adjustments.

Collectors prioritize recent and retro booster boxes, Structure Decks, Legendary Collections, and Battles of Legend releases. Quarter Century series and sealed products with provenance attract additional interest, particularly from those seeking graded or collectible cards.
